Understanding the EVA, TPR, and PVC Pulping Production Lines

2026-05-09

The production line for EVA (Ethylene Vinyl Acetate), TPR (Thermoplastic Rubber), and P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ride) is a complex system that involves several stages of processing to produce high-quality materials. The first step in this process is the raw material preparation, where the raw materials are mixed together and heated to form a homogeneous mixture. This mixture is then extruded through a die into pellets or sheets.

In the next stage, the pellets or sheets are further processed by passing them through a cooling section, which helps to solidify the material and remove any excess heat. The cooled material is then packaged and stored until it is needed for further processing.

The final stage of the production line involves the use of specialized equipment to convert the pellets or sheets into finished products. This may involve cutting, stamping, or other operations that create the desired shape and size of the final product.
